Transaction 8c8686e1266245145cc1af53aa31e24fde5b9161ddd9afd0a08b1e31e67fcaf4
1 Input
1 Output
-
8c8686e1266245145cc1af53aa31e24fde5b9161ddd9afd0a08b1e31e67fcaf4:0
- value
- 385192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c96246194352fb00084d22a6f38843eb2bc0b946 OP_EQUAL
- address
- 3L3qUHaMoUgitD9sFxyfTt6GxCKmT4MHfB